Transaction 655837dbe7a83bde962f0703f1c023c3b651366377cf5dfdb14c6de21077d675
1 Input
1 Output
-
655837dbe7a83bde962f0703f1c023c3b651366377cf5dfdb14c6de21077d675:0
- value
- 417384
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c610304252650b66171385a714511007b2d1b7d OP_EQUAL
- address
- 3LKfzB3PkKoJMvuJ8LXMLv4Qc8firv2KLF